BitGo is the leading Bitcoin security platform and a pioneer of multi-sig technology. The company offers an enterprise-grade, multi-sig, multi-user Bitcoin wallet, as well as API access to its underlying security platform. BitGo was founded by Mike Belshe and Ben Davenport, veterans in online security, digital currency, and financial technology. Investors and advisors include elite Silicon Valley venture capitalists and angels, and Bitcoin industry insiders who have backed successful companies like PayPal, Netscape, Red Hat, Proofpoint, Verisign, Juniper Networks, Yammer, and Tesla.
Matthew Parrella is Chief Compliance Officer at BitGo. Previously, Matthew held various senior legal leadership roles in the industry.
